What is Polyvinyl Alcohol?

REFRESH 1.4% Polyvinyl Alcohol Drops provide soothing relief for dry, irritated eyes. These ophthalmic drops are designed to lubricate and comfort, making them ideal for daily eye care.

What is Polyvinyl Alcohol used for?

REFRESH 1.4% Polyvinyl Alcohol Drops are commonly used to relieve dryness and irritation in the eyes. They can be used to alleviate discomfort caused by environmental factors, prolonged screen use, or contact lens wear. These drops help maintain eye moisture, providing relief from symptoms associated with dry eye syndrome.

What are the side effects of Polyvinyl Alcohol?

When applied, REFRESH 1.4% Polyvinyl Alcohol Drops may cause a temporary blurring of vision, which usually clears quickly. Some users might experience mild stinging or redness upon application, though these effects are generally short-lived.

What precautions apply to Polyvinyl Alcohol?

Before using REFRESH 1.4% Polyvinyl Alcohol Drops, ensure your hands are clean to avoid contamination. Avoid touching the tip of the dropper to prevent infection. If you experience persistent discomfort or worsening symptoms, discontinue use and consult a healthcare professional.

What does Polyvinyl Alcohol interact with?

REFRESH 1.4% Polyvinyl Alcohol Drops are generally safe for most users. However, if you are using other eye medications, it is advisable to wait at least 5-10 minutes between applications to avoid potential interactions. Always follow the instructions provided with the product.

Frequently asked questions

What is REFRESH 1.4% Polyvinyl Alcohol used for?+
REFRESH 1.4% Polyvinyl Alcohol Drops are used to relieve dryness and irritation in the eyes, providing lubrication and comfort.
How should I use REFRESH 1.4% Polyvinyl Alcohol Drops?+
Tilt your head back, pull down your lower eyelid, and apply the recommended number of drops into your eye. Avoid touching the dropper tip to your eye or any surface.
Can I use REFRESH 1.4% Polyvinyl Alcohol Drops with contact lenses?+
Yes, these drops can be used with contact lenses. However, always follow the specific instructions provided by your eye care professional.
What should I do if I experience side effects from REFRESH 1.4% Polyvinyl Alcohol Drops?+
If you experience persistent discomfort or worsening symptoms, discontinue use and consult a healthcare professional.
How should I store REFRESH 1.4% Polyvinyl Alcohol Drops?+
Store the drops at room temperature, away from direct sunlight and heat. Keep the bottle tightly closed when not in use.
